Q1. A teacher says, 'You must not copy during the test.' What is the function of must not?

A weak possibility
B polite request
C advice only
D prohibition or strong rule Correct

Explanation

Must not is stronger than should not. In this test-room sentence, the teacher is not giving optional advice; the teacher is stating a prohibition. Karan’s duty-chart examples use the same strong-rule force.

Q2. Meena tells Karan, 'You ___ check the spelling before you submit.' Which modal gives advice, not compulsion?

A must
B will
C can
D should Correct

Explanation

The sentence is a friendly recommendation before submission. Should is the correct modal for advice. Must would be too strong, can would discuss ability, and will would predict rather than advise.

Q3. Which option best repairs the error in Meena's sentence: 'I can to help Devika after class'?

A I can help Devika after class. Correct
B I can helped Devika after class.
C I can helps Devika after class.
D I can helping Devika after class.

Explanation

The repair is purely about the form after can. Meena wants to say she is able to help Devika, so can is fine, but the following verb must be help, not to help, helped, helps, or helping.

Q4. Devika looks at dark clouds and says, 'It ___ rain after lunch.' Which modal shows weak possibility?

A must
B will
C might Correct
D should

Explanation

Devika has evidence but not certainty. Might is weaker than may and much weaker than must or will. The item tests the strength scale, not the future tense of the main verb rain.

Q5. Assertion: 'Would you open the window?' is a polite request. Reason: Would can soften a request in classroom English.

A Both assertion and reason are true, and the reason explains the assertion. Correct
B Both are true, but the reason does not explain the assertion.
C The assertion is true, but the reason is false.
D The assertion is false, but the reason is true.

Explanation

The stem is an assertion-reason item. Would does not merely mark future time here; it reduces directness and makes the classroom request polite. Therefore both parts are true and the reason explains the assertion.
